Installation Guide

The unit must be installed indoors on a flat surface. To install the exhaust hose: 1. Firmly click the exhaust duct into the rear opening. 2. Attach the other end to the window slider kit. 3. Secure the slider kit in the window frame using the provided screws and foam seal. Keep the exhaust duct as short and straight as possible to maintain cooling efficiency.

Operation Instructions

The unit can be controlled via the top panel or the included remote. Modes include Auto, Cool, Dry, and Fan. Temperature can be adjusted between 60°F - 90°F (16°C - 32°C). The unit features an ECO mode (accessible via control panel in Cool mode) and a Sleep mode (remote only). Timer functions allow for scheduled power on/off.

Wi-Fi and App Connection

Download the DELLA+ app from the App Store or Google Play. Register an account, then select Add Device. Ensure your phone is connected to a 2.4 GHz Wi-Fi network. Follow the in-app prompts to pair the air conditioner.

Water Drainage

When the internal tank is full, the display shows FL. Move the unit to a drain location, remove the bottom drain plug, and empty the water. For continuous drainage during Dry mode, remove the upper drain plug and attach a drain hose leading to a suitable drainage area.

Care and Maintenance

Always shut down and unplug the unit before cleaning. Clean the exterior with a soft, damp cloth. Remove air filters regularly and clean them with a vacuum or warm water with mild detergent. Ensure filters are completely dry before re-installation.

Common problems

Appliance is nonoperational

Check for power failure, ensure the plug is connected, or check if the power breaker has tripped.

Appliance does not start

Wait 4 minutes for the internal reset cycle or adjust the temperature setting to be lower than the current room temperature.

Poor cooling effect

Clear obstructions from the vent, clean the air filter, close open doors/windows, or check if the room size is too large for the unit.

Noise or vibration

Ensure the unit is placed on a flat, even surface.

Before use

  • Ensure the unit is on flat ground.
  • Maintain 50 cm (19.7 inches) clearance from walls/obstacles.
  • Plug directly into a grounded wall outlet (no extension cords).
  • Verify the voltage matches product specifications.
  • Ensure the exhaust hose is properly installed and straight.
  • Check that the air filter is clean and installed.
